Gaza - Together - A number of citizens were martyred and others were injured, on Saturday evening, in raids launched by Israeli occupation aircraft on the northern, central and southern Gaza Strip, while clashes continue between the resistance fighters and the occupation forces in several areas of the Strip.
A local source reported that 9 were killed and a number of wounded in an Israeli raid on a home for the Al-Askari family in the Tal Al-Zaatar area in the northern Gaza Strip.
The occupation aircraft also bombed the headquarters of the United Nations Development Programme, UNDP, which houses displaced people, in the Al-Nasr neighborhood in Gaza City, resulting in martyrs and wounded at the place.
Medical sources reported that a number of martyrs and wounded were reported in an Israeli raid on the home of the Rantisi family in the Shaboura camp in Rafah, south of the Gaza Strip. A female citizen was also martyred and others were injured in a raid on the home of the Abu Abda family in the Nuseirat camp in the central Gaza Strip.
Al-Shifa Medical Complex announced the death of a second child inside the incubators in the premature infants section, after the electrical generator stopped and the complex went out of service, while the occupation aircraft continued to target the complex, bombing the water well and its tanks.
Earlier, local sources reported that five citizens were martyred and others were injured when the occupation aircraft bombed a house for the Al-Najjar family in the Al-Tahlia area in Khan Yunis. A female citizen was also martyred in a bombing of the Al-Kazemi family’s house near the Grand Mosque in the center of the city.
It also reported that a number of martyrs and wounded were reported in the occupation aircraft’s bombing of a house in the Nuseirat camp in the central Gaza Strip.
The occupation aircraft targeted with two missiles a four-story residential building belonging to the Al-Farra family in the Sheikh Nasser area, east of Khan Yunis, which led to the complete destruction of the building, without causing casualties after the building had been evacuated earlier.
The sources added that the occupation aircraft targeted a house for the Shaheen family in the new town of Abasan, agricultural land in the town of Bani Suhaila, east of Khan Yunis, and agricultural land to the west.
The Israeli occupation forces continued to target hospitals and their surroundings, and the occupation aircraft launched raids on the vicinity of the Indonesian hospital in the town of Beit Lahia, north of the Gaza Strip. The occupation air force also launched a series of raids on Al-Shifa Medical Complex and its surroundings, west of Gaza.
The Palestinian Red Crescent Society said that occupation tanks and military vehicles are surrounding its Al-Quds Hospital in Gaza from all sides, and are stationed 20 meters away from it.
She added that the hospital building was completely shaking as a result of the artillery shelling, in addition to heavy gunfire on the hospital, which led to a number of casualties, in addition to a state of panic among patients and displaced people.
Doctors Without Borders said that Gaza hospitals were subjected to continuous bombing during the past 24 hours, while medical teams and patients were still inside them.
The organization called for an urgent halt to the shooting at Gaza Strip hospitals so that doctors could save the lives of the injured.
Fierce clashes are taking place between the resistance factions and the occupation forces in several areas in the Gaza Strip, including the vicinity of Al-Shifa Hospital.
At a time when the aggression and bombing of inhabited areas and homes continues, the occupation targeted hospitals in northern Gaza and its vehicles besieged Al-Quds Hospital, while clashes were reported to have broken out in the vicinity of Al-Shifa Hospital.
An Israeli official said that "clashes are taking place with Hamas members in the vicinity of Al-Shifa Hospital," while he considered that "the allegations about targeting the hospital are false and that no one has targeted it."
The death toll from the ongoing Israeli aggression on the Gaza Strip since October 7 has risen to more than 11,100 martyrs, including more than 8,000 children and women, an infinite toll.
